Responsibilities
- Ensures compliance with all governmental laws and regulations, TX minimum standards, policies and procedures
- Maintains confidentiality of all agency, client and personnel information,
- Coordinates the administrative and clinical functions of the operation
- Coordinates all personnel matters, including hiring, assigning duties, training supervision, evaluation of employees, and terminations in conjunction with the Executive Director
- Ensures that persons whose behavior and/or health status presents a danger to the clients are not allowed at the operation.
- Supervises and supports Therapists, Volunteers, and administrative staff
- Coordinates the communication for the entire Treatment Team
- Acts as the primary liaison with all referring agencies.
- Manages intake, referral, and discharge processes for the agency
- Reports immediately any suspected incident of abuse/neglect/exploitation of a child in care to the Child Abuse Hotline
- Facilitates pre-service and in service training for employees
- Oversees the daily office management and maintenance
- Reviews records for compliance
- Provides on-going supervision for all children placed
- Attends court hearings as needed
- Attends weekly staff meetings
- In charge of approving all treatment plans and treatment plan updates
- Markets Trinity Guidance RTC programs and services in conjunction with the Executive Director
- Develops and maintains relationships with other social service agencies in order to maximize services built on inter-agency collaboration
- Attend monthly supervision meetings with the Executive Director.
- Attend Admission, Dismissal and Review (ARD) meetings for children
- Attend Permanency Planning Team meetings for children
- Attend court hearings for children
- Provide training to staff as needed
- Performs any additional tasks as assigned by the Executive Director
Skills
- Must hold a current license as Licensed Child-Care Administrator
- Bachelors or Master’s degree in social work or related behavioral field from an accredited college or university
- A minimum of two year’s experience providing services to children who have been removed from their homes.
- Familiarity with the social services delivery of services of public and private agencies.
- Be physically, mentally and emotionally capable of performing assigned tasks
-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, PowerPoint) and Google Workspace applications.
- Excellent organizational skills with attention to detail and accuracy in work.
- Effective time management abilities to prioritize tasks efficiently.
- Bilingual capabilities are a plus for effective communication with diverse clients.
- Previous experience as a personal assistant or in office management is preferred.
- Strong phone etiquette and interpersonal skills for professional interactions.
